The Weeknd and Mike Dean Share Four New Songs: Listen

The tracks appear on Dean’s newly released album 4:23

The Weeknd and Mike Dean have joined forces on a handful of new songs, which appear on Dean’s new album 4:23. The Weeknd sings and has co-writing credits on “Artificial Intelligence, “Defame Moi,” “More Coke!!,” and “Emotionless.” He also picks up an executive producer credit across the LP. Abel Tesfaye and the producer have worked together closely on multiple occasions. They most recently collaborated on “Double Fantasy,” the new Future-featuring lead single for the forthcoming HBO series The Idol. Tesfaye stars in the series, and he co-created it alongside Reza Fahim and Euphoria’s Sam Levinson. 

The production has faced some criticism from crew members, who claimed that much of the original material created under director Amy Seimetz had been heavily re-worked at Levinson’s direction. Dean also appears in the show, which premieres on June 4.
